Chromic Acid
An oxidizing agent composed of chromium trioxide or sodium dichromate in water; used for cleaning laboratory glassware and in oxidation reactions.
2° Alcohol
Also known as a secondary alcohol, it is an alcohol where the hydroxyl (-OH) group is attached to a carbon atom that is bonded to two other carbon atoms.
Organic Product
A chemical compound of organic origin, typically resulting from the chemical reactions of organic compounds.
Reaction
A process leading to the transformation of one set of chemical substances to another.
